Potential Side Effects of Natrelle Breast Implants
Like any surgical procedure, there are some potential side effects associated with Natrelle breast implants. These may include:
1. Infection: As with any surgery, there is a risk of infection at the incision site. This can typically be managed with antibiotics, but in some cases, the implant may need to be removed.
2. Capsular contracture: This occurs when the scar tissue around the implant tightens, causing the breast to feel hard and sometimes causing pain or changes in appearance.
3. Implant rupture or leakage: While rare, breast implants can rupture or leak over time, which may require surgical intervention to remove or replace the implant.
4. Changes in sensation: Some patients report changes in breast and nipple sensation, either increased or decreased, after breast augmentation surgery.
5. Scarring: Incisions made during the surgery can result in scarring, which may be more or less noticeable depending on the patient's healing process and the surgeon's techniques.
It's important to note that the majority of patients who undergo Natrelle breast implants in Las Vegas experience a successful outcome with minimal side effects. However, it's crucial to discuss the potential risks and complications with your surgeon during the consultation process.
Choosing a Reputable Surgeon in Las Vegas
When considering Natrelle breast implants in Las Vegas, the most crucial factor is selecting a qualified and experienced surgeon. Here are some key things to look for:
1. Board certification: Ensure that your surgeon is board-certified in plastic surgery, as this demonstrates a high level of training and expertise.
2. Specialization: Look for a surgeon who specializes in breast augmentation and has extensive experience performing Natrelle breast implant procedures.
3. Patient reviews: Check online reviews and testimonials from the surgeon's previous patients to get a sense of their level of care, bedside manner, and overall satisfaction with the results.
4. Before-and-after photos: Ask to see a portfolio of the surgeon's previous work to get an idea of their aesthetic approach and the quality of their results.
5. Open communication: A reputable surgeon should be transparent about the procedure, the risks, and the expected outcomes, and should be willing to address any concerns you may have.
By choosing a well-qualified and experienced surgeon in Las Vegas, you can increase the chances of a successful outcome and minimize the risk of complications from your Natrelle breast implant procedure.

Q: How long do Natrelle breast implants last?
A: Breast implants, including Natrelle, are not considered lifetime devices. They may need to be replaced at some point due to rupture, capsular contracture, or other issues. On average, breast implants can last 10-15 years, but this can vary from patient to patient.
